Transaction 028760dd31e9f27291f7fc803dfc0b667d72831b17cd7d53c19f0830e232950e
3 Input
2 Outputs
- 028760dd31e9f27291f7fc803dfc0b667d72831b17cd7d53c19f0830e232950e:0
- 028760dd31e9f27291f7fc803dfc0b667d72831b17cd7d53c19f0830e232950e:1
value 34580000
address 3MrSCTJcj2qNeecqA7BTg2fusHUGUpveQs
value 2476701
address 3BMEXvsUWUfarbMzVoogdyGf45VEBkZTiT